Planar multi-junction electrochemical cell

This patent describes a planar multi-junction electrochemical pump for pumping an electrochemically active fluid, the pump comprising: a container defining an inlet chamber in a first portion thereof and an outlet chamber in a second portion thereof; a single electrolytic membrane disposed within the container between the chambers and forming therebetween a gas-tight seal; a plurality of pairs of electrodes disposed on either side of and in contact with the electrolytic membrane, the electrodes in the inlet chamber being separated from one another by spaces and the electrodes in the outlet chamber being separated from one another by spaces; means for electrically connecting the electrodes; and means for applying an electrical voltage to the electrodes to establish a voltage gradient across the membrane to convert the fluid into ions in the inlet chamber, propel the ions through the membrane into the outer chamber, and reconvert the ions into fluid in the outlet chamber whereby the fluid is pumped from the inlet chamber into the outlet chamber.
